#5262d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5262dc is composed of 32.2% red, 38.4%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 59.2%. #5262dc color hex could be obtained by blending #a4c4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5262d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5262dc has RGB values of R:82, G:98,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5399260.

Shades and Tints of #5262d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5262d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92939c is the less saturated color, while #3249fc is the most saturated one.
